Abstract
Tetraiodocobaltates with an empirical formula of [AAH2] [CoI4] were obtained where AA is the diamine: 1,3-propanediamine(tn); 1,5-pentanediamine(pn) or cadaverine; 1,6-hexanediamine (hn); 1,7-heptanediamine(hpn) and 1,8-octanediamine(on). Magnetic studies and the electronic spectra revealed the tetrahedral structure of the CoI2- 4 ion present in these compounds. The I.R. spectra indicated protonation of the amine groups. The splitting energy of the crystal field (10Dq) and the interelectronic repulsion parameter (B) were calculated from the electronic spectra.
